Part 4A - Connecting Monologue to Electribe
To use the Korg Monologue to process external audio, such as a guitar or another synthesizer, follow these steps: 1. Physical Connection and Global Setup Connect the Source: Plug your external device into the AUDIO IN jack (monaural 1/4" phone jack) on the rear panel of the Monologue. Enable Audio In: Navigate to the GLOBAL EDIT menu (Button 4, Page 3) and ensure the Audio In parameter is set to On ; if it is set to Off, signals coming into the jack will be muted. 2. Mixer and Sound Configuration Mixer Settings: To hear only the external audio without the internal oscillators, turn the VCO 1 and VCO 2 knobs in the mixer section all the way down to zero. Signal Path: The external audio enters the signal path after the mixer section but before the filter , meaning your external sound will be processed by the Monologue’s analog filter and drive circuit. 3.
